maldistribution /ˌmaldɪstrɪˈbjuːʃ(ə)n /noun [mass noun]Uneven, inefficient, or unfair distribution of something: the maldistribution of wealth...- However, Ellis and colleagues demonstrated maldistribution of microcirculatory blood flow in the skeletal muscle of septic rats.
- There were, indeed, dangers, and they did not stop with maldistribution of wealth.
- This was at the height of the submarine menace, when men were losing their lives daily to bring in supplies, and this maldistribution just didn't seem right.
Derivatives maldistributed adjective ...- Also called the fallacy of maldistributed middle.
- California's physicians are maldistributed by specialty, geographic location, and race/ethnicity.
- First of all, there is enough food in the world to feed everyone - it's just grossly maldistributed.
